Μετάβαση στο κύριο περιεχόμενο

Πώς να δείτε την τιμή που ταιριάζει από κάτω προς τα πάνω στο Excel;

Κανονικά, η λειτουργία Vlookup μπορεί να σας βοηθήσει να βρείτε τα δεδομένα από πάνω προς τα κάτω για να λάβετε την πρώτη τιμή αντιστοίχισης από τη λίστα. Αλλά, μερικές φορές, πρέπει να κοιτάξετε από κάτω προς τα πάνω για να εξαγάγετε την τελευταία αντίστοιχη τιμή. Έχετε καλές ιδέες για να αντιμετωπίσετε αυτήν την εργασία στο Excel;

Δείτε την τελευταία τιμή αντιστοίχισης από κάτω προς τα πάνω με τον τύπο

Δείτε την τελευταία τιμή αντιστοίχισης από κάτω προς τα πάνω με μια χρήσιμη λειτουργία


Δείτε την τελευταία τιμή αντιστοίχισης από κάτω προς τα πάνω με τον τύπο

Για να δείτε την τιμή που ταιριάζει από κάτω προς τα πάνω, ο παρακάτω τύπος LOOKUP μπορεί να σας βοηθήσει, κάντε τα εξής:

Εισαγάγετε τον παρακάτω τύπο σε ένα κενό κελί όπου θέλετε να λάβετε το αποτέλεσμα:

=LOOKUP(2,1/($A$2:$A$17=D2),$B$2:$B$17)

Στη συνέχεια, σύρετε τη λαβή πλήρωσης προς τα κάτω στα κελιά που θέλετε να λάβετε τα αποτελέσματα, οι τελευταίες αντίστοιχες τιμές θα επιστραφούν ταυτόχρονα, δείτε το στιγμιότυπο οθόνης:

Note: Στον παραπάνω τύπο: A2: A17 δείχνει τη στήλη που αναζητάτε, D2 είναι τα κριτήρια που θέλετε να επιστρέψετε τα σχετικά δεδομένα και Β2: Β17 είναι η λίστα που περιέχει την τιμή που θέλετε να επιστρέψετε.


Δείτε την τελευταία τιμή αντιστοίχισης από κάτω προς τα πάνω με μια χρήσιμη λειτουργία

Εάν έχετε Kutools για Excel, Με τους ΕΠΙΣΚΟΠΗΣΤΕ από κάτω προς τα πάνω δυνατότητα, μπορείτε επίσης να επιλύσετε αυτήν την εργασία χωρίς να θυμάστε κανένα τύπο.

Συμβουλές:Για να το εφαρμόσετε ΕΠΙΣΚΟΠΗΣΤΕ από κάτω προς τα πάνω χαρακτηριστικό, πρώτα, πρέπει να κατεβάσετε το Kutools για Excelκαι, στη συνέχεια, εφαρμόστε τη λειτουργία γρήγορα και εύκολα.

Μετά την εγκατάσταση Kutools για Excel, κάντε το ως εξής:

1. Κλίκ Kutools > Σούπερ LOOKUP > ΕΠΙΣΚΟΠΗΣΤΕ από κάτω προς τα πάνω, δείτε το στιγμιότυπο οθόνης:

2. Στην ΕΠΙΣΚΟΠΗΣΤΕ από κάτω προς τα πάνω πλαίσιο διαλόγου, κάντε τις ακόλουθες λειτουργίες:

  • Επιλέξτε τα κελιά τιμών αναζήτησης και τα κελιά εξόδου από το Τιμές αναζήτησης και εύρος εξόδου Ενότητα;
  • Στη συνέχεια, καθορίστε τα αντίστοιχα στοιχεία από το Φασμα ΔΕΔΟΜΕΝΩΝ τμήμα.

3. Στη συνέχεια, κάντε κλικ στο κουμπί OK κουμπί, όλες οι τελευταίες τιμές αντιστοίχισης θα επιστραφούν ταυτόχρονα, δείτε το στιγμιότυπο οθόνης:

Κατεβάστε και δωρεάν δοκιμή Kutools για Excel τώρα!


Σχετικά άρθρα:

  • Τιμές Vlookup σε πολλά φύλλα εργασίας
  • Στο excel, μπορούμε εύκολα να εφαρμόσουμε τη συνάρτηση vlookup για να επιστρέψουμε τις αντίστοιχες τιμές σε έναν πίνακα ενός φύλλου εργασίας. Όμως, έχετε σκεφτεί ποτέ πώς να κοιτάξετε την τιμή σε πολλά φύλλα εργασίας; Υποθέτοντας ότι έχω τα ακόλουθα τρία φύλλα εργασίας με εύρος δεδομένων, και τώρα, θέλω να λάβω μέρος των αντίστοιχων τιμών με βάση τα κριτήρια από αυτά τα τρία φύλλα εργασίας.
  • Χρησιμοποιήστε την ακριβή και κατά προσέγγιση αντιστοίχιση Vlookup στο Excel
  • Στο Excel, το vlookup είναι μια από τις πιο σημαντικές συναρτήσεις για να αναζητήσουμε μια τιμή στην αριστερή στήλη του πίνακα και να επιστρέψουμε την τιμή στην ίδια σειρά του εύρους. Αλλά, εφαρμόζετε με επιτυχία τη λειτουργία vlookup στο Excel; Σε αυτό το άρθρο, θα μιλήσω για τον τρόπο χρήσης της λειτουργίας vlookup στο Excel.
  • Vlookup για επιστροφή κενής ή συγκεκριμένης τιμής αντί για 0 ​​ή N / A
  • Κανονικά, όταν εφαρμόζετε τη συνάρτηση vlookup για να επιστρέψετε την αντίστοιχη τιμή, εάν το κελί που ταιριάζει είναι κενό, θα επιστρέψει 0 και αν δεν βρεθεί η τιμή αντιστοίχισης, θα εμφανιστεί μια τιμή # N / A σφάλματος όπως φαίνεται στο παρακάτω στιγμιότυπο οθόνης. Αντί να εμφανίζεται η τιμή 0 ή # N / A, πώς μπορείτε να την εμφανίσετε κενό κελί ή άλλη συγκεκριμένη τιμή κειμένου;
  • Vlookup και συνδυασμένες πολλαπλές αντίστοιχες τιμές στο Excel
  • Όπως όλοι γνωρίζουμε, η συνάρτηση Vlookup στο Excel μπορεί να μας βοηθήσει να αναζητήσουμε μια τιμή και να επιστρέψουμε τα αντίστοιχα δεδομένα σε μια άλλη στήλη, αλλά γενικά, μπορεί να πάρει την πρώτη σχετική τιμή μόνο εάν υπάρχουν πολλά δεδομένα που ταιριάζουν. Σε αυτό το άρθρο, θα μιλήσω για το πώς να προβάλετε και να συνδυάσετε πολλές αντίστοιχες τιμές σε ένα μόνο κελί ή σε κάθετη λίστα.

Τα καλύτερα εργαλεία παραγωγικότητας γραφείου

Δημοφιλή χαρακτηριστικά: Εύρεση, επισήμανση ή αναγνώριση διπλότυπων   |  Διαγραφή κενών γραμμών   |  Συνδυάστε στήλες ή κελιά χωρίς απώλεια δεδομένων   |   Γύρος χωρίς φόρμουλα ...
Σούπερ Αναζήτηση: VLookup πολλαπλών κριτηρίων    VLookup πολλαπλών τιμών  |   VLookup σε πολλά φύλλα   |   Ασαφής αναζήτηση ....
Σύνθετη αναπτυσσόμενη λίστα: Γρήγορη δημιουργία αναπτυσσόμενης λίστας   |  Εξαρτημένη αναπτυσσόμενη λίστα   |  Πολλαπλή αναπτυσσόμενη λίστα ....
Διαχειριστής στήλης: Προσθέστε έναν συγκεκριμένο αριθμό στηλών  |  Μετακίνηση στηλών  |  Εναλλαγή κατάστασης ορατότητας κρυφών στηλών  |  Συγκρίνετε εύρη και στήλες ...
Επιλεγμένα Χαρακτηριστικά: Εστίαση πλέγματος   |  Προβολή σχεδίου   |   Μεγάλη Formula Bar    Διαχείριση βιβλίου εργασίας & φύλλου   |  Βιβλιοθήκη πόρων (Αυτόματο κείμενο)   |  Επιλογή ημερομηνίας   |  Συνδυάστε φύλλα εργασίας   |  Κρυπτογράφηση/Αποκρυπτογράφηση κελιών    Αποστολή email ανά λίστα   |  Σούπερ φίλτρο   |   Ειδικό φίλτρο (φίλτρο με έντονη γραφή/πλάγια γραφή/διαγραφή...) ...
Κορυφαία 15 σύνολα εργαλείων12 Κείμενο Εργαλεία (Προσθήκη κειμένου, Κατάργηση χαρακτήρων, ...)   |   50 + Διάγραμμα Τύποι (Gantt διάγραμμα, ...)   |   40+ Πρακτικό ΜΑΘΗΜΑΤΙΚΟΙ τυποι (Υπολογίστε την ηλικία με βάση τα γενέθλια, ...)   |   19 Εισαγωγή Εργαλεία (Εισαγωγή κωδικού QR, Εισαγωγή εικόνας από το μονοπάτι, ...)   |   12 Μετατροπή Εργαλεία (Αριθμοί σε λέξεις, Μετατροπή Συναλλάγματος, ...)   |   7 Συγχώνευση & διαχωρισμός Εργαλεία (Σύνθετες σειρές συνδυασμού, Διαίρεση κελιών, ...)   |   ... κι αλλα

Αυξήστε τις δεξιότητές σας στο Excel με τα Kutools για Excel και απολαύστε την αποτελεσματικότητα όπως ποτέ πριν. Το Kutools για Excel προσφέρει πάνω από 300 προηγμένες δυνατότητες για την ενίσχυση της παραγωγικότητας και την εξοικονόμηση χρόνου.  Κάντε κλικ εδώ για να αποκτήσετε τη δυνατότητα που χρειάζεστε περισσότερο...

kte καρτέλα 201905


Το Office Tab φέρνει τη διεπαφή με καρτέλες στο Office και κάνει την εργασία σας πολύ πιο εύκολη

  • Ενεργοποίηση επεξεργασίας και ανάγνωσης καρτελών σε Word, Excel, PowerPoint, Publisher, Access, Visio και Project.
  • Ανοίξτε και δημιουργήστε πολλά έγγραφα σε νέες καρτέλες του ίδιου παραθύρου και όχι σε νέα παράθυρα.
  • Αυξάνει την παραγωγικότητά σας κατά 50% και μειώνει εκατοντάδες κλικ του ποντικιού για εσάς κάθε μέρα!
Comments (6)
No ratings yet. Be the first to rate!
This comment was minimized by the moderator on the site
An update to this old post for anyone searching like I was ;-)

I was looking for the same functionality. Ended up using XLOOKUP which allows you to set a search mode for "last to first".

This was in Microsoft 365 Apps for Enterprise.

Hope it helps someone in the future.

Thanks
Rob
This comment was minimized by the moderator on the site
Excellent solution using the LOOKUP function, exactly what I was looking for!
I would like to add that with the hope it would help anyone who needed a similar solution to what I was looking for. If you want to return the row number of the matching value (not within the range, but rather within the entire column), you should use the following format by adding in the ROW function:=LOOKUP(2,1/($A$2:$A$17=D2),ROW($A$2:$A$17))
This comment was minimized by the moderator on the site
Hi All,
Are there any other ways to do this? While it works it is extremely resource intensive for large data sets.


Thanks,
This comment was minimized by the moderator on the site
The actual value of the "2" is irrelevant, it could be any number greater than 1 and less than infinity.

I believe the second term i.e. "1/($A$2:$A$19=D2)" creates an array by evaluating each cell in the range and if it is equal to D2 (a boolean test) it equates this to 1/TRUE, which as TRUE is 1 => 1. If it doesn't equal D2 it equates this to 1/FALSE, which as FALSE is 0 => infinity or Not a Number.

LOOKUP then takes over and searches for 2 in this array, which of course it can't find as they are either 1 or infinity.

If LOOKUP can't find a match it matches the highest number that is less than or equal to 2. Which is 1.

I'm not quite sure why this turns out to be the last occurrence of 1 though. Maybe LOOKUP (unlike VLOOKUP) always searches upwards?
This comment was minimized by the moderator on the site
I do not understand either why this picks the last occurrence of 1. It works, but WHY??!!

(Thanks, anyway!)
This comment was minimized by the moderator on the site
Hi Please can you explain this formula "=LOOKUP(2,1/($A$2:$A$19=D2),$B$2:$B$19)". It's worked for what I want to acheive very well, but I do not completely understand how. When typed into Excel, it shows that "2" is the lookup value, but we are actually looking up "D2" in this formula. Also what is "1/" doing on the lookup vector? Please could you break this formula down to explain how it works? Thanks
There are no comments posted here yet
Please leave your comments in English
Posting as Guest
×
Rate this post:
0   Characters
Suggested Locations